Transaction c38fd72836060e48364ee2868333be473713efb08ddfd40bb76f5af00f89869a
1 Input
1 Output
-
c38fd72836060e48364ee2868333be473713efb08ddfd40bb76f5af00f89869a:0
- value
- 510779
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d54a4241042e1c6129d70abc5e1720d0d512df0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 183tRk6817hymmePW8LFC1HV6sW18HQNqs